On Tuesday, acting White House chief of staff Mick Mulvaney said in a court filing that he would not bring a lawsuit challenging a subpoena for his testimony in the impeachment probe into President Trump, adding that at the direction of the president he would not cooperate with the investigation.
The move was a reversal for Mulvaney, who on Monday said in a court filing that he planned to bring a lawsuit.
